A FLEMISH HISTORICAL TAPESTRY
LAST QUARTER 17TH CENTURY
Depicting Cleopatra Dissolving the Pearl, from the Story of Mark Anthony and Cleopatra, the couple seated at a table, waited on by an attendant, with the infant Cupid to the foreground, within a foliate and floral border, monogrammed 'AB' flanked by fleurs de lys to the bottom left edge
110¼ x 115 in. (280 x 292 cm.)
拍場告示
Please note this tapestry is French and woven at Aubusson.
